F()macro+OLED

_Quasar_

✩✩✩✩✩✩✩
30 Июл 2021
52
0
Пользуясь таким методом пытался вывести строки на дисплей.

Часть кода
C++:
  oled.clear();           // Очищаем буфер
  oled.home();            // Курсор в левый верхний угол
  oled.print              // Вывод всех пунктов
  (F(
     "  Par 0:\n"   // Не забываем про '\n' - символ переноса строки
     "  Par 1:\n"
     "  Par 2:\n"
     "  Par 3:\n"
     "  Par 4:\n"
     "  Par 5:\n"
   ));
  //printPointer(pointer);  // Вывод указателя
  oled.update();          // Выводим кадр на дисплей
Почему-то физически получил ступенчатый вывод на дисплей.
Это из-за плохого дисплея?
1658826926716.jpg
 

_Quasar_

✩✩✩✩✩✩✩
30 Июл 2021
52
0
Может стоит тогда еще добавить символ возврата каретки ?
Я так понимаю в начало строки.. Я просто учусь по урокам З_А. Думаю не смогу понять о каком символе идет речь.. Пробовал как а принтLN но толку 0.
 

_Quasar_

✩✩✩✩✩✩✩
30 Июл 2021
52
0
Погуглив и методом тыка получил такое \n\r , вроде все работает. Даже не знал как правильно гуглить,